Real-World Deployment of Massively Parallel Sampling-Based MPC for Contact-Rich Manipulation (opens in new tab)
Sampling-based Model Predictive Control (SMPC) is a promising strategy for contact-rich robotic manipulation, combining gradient-free optimization with massively parallel GPU simulation. Yet, most prior work relies on simplified dynamics or remains confined to simulation.
